Very nice bedroom, quite large, very clean, and also very comfortable Small hotel, so that you almost feel at home (5 bedrooms). Very quiet area along a lovely canal and well located. People are also very friendly. The only minor drawback could be the breakfast that is not very frugal. more

We stayed at the Orlando for two nights and had 2 rooms. They were both very stylish and clean. The stairs of a canal house are very narrow and steep so it would be wise to take two small bags rather than one large one.
